Carmakers are raising a ruckus. Just as demand for autos was beginning to pick up again, global automakers like Ford, Fiat-Chrysler, Toyota, Subaru, Volkswagen, and Nissan have been forced to slam on the brakes, laying off autoworkers and shuttering factories. The problem: There aren't enough chips to supply the auto industry. There's a global shortage.
